What is Future Radar and Why is It Important?

Future radar, or forecast radar, provides predictive imagery of precipitation patterns, helping users anticipate storm developments and plan accordingly. This feature is especially vital in regions prone to severe weather, where timely information can enhance safety and preparedness.

What Are the Key Features to Look for in a Storm Tracking App?

When evaluating storm tracking apps, consider the following features:

  • High-Resolution Radar: Ensures clear visualization of precipitation patterns.

  • Real-Time Alerts: Provides timely notifications for severe weather warnings.

  • User-Friendly Interface: Allows for quick interpretation of complex data.

  • Additional Layers: Features like lightning tracking, hurricane paths, and wildfire maps can offer a more comprehensive understanding of the weather situation.
